FreeBASIC 0.21.0 für Windows
Download
- EXE-Datei (6,04 MB)
- GPL
- Plattformen:
- FreeBASIC 0.20.0
- Angelegt von Sebastian am 23.07.2010
Bewertung
Punkte: 5,0 bei 1 Stimmen(Zum Abstimmen auf die Sterne klicken.)
Nach zwei Jahren Entwicklungszeit wurde am 23. Juli 2010 die hier verfügbare Version 0.21.0 des FreeBASIC-Compilers veröffentlicht. Sie bringt eine ganze Reihe neuer Features mit, darunter technische Verbesserungen des Compilers wie auch Erweiterungen der Sprache. Das hier vorliegende Downloadpaket enthält den Compiler für Windows inklusive Installationsassistent.
(Hinweis: Alternativ steht auch ein Paket ohne Setupassistent im ZIP- oder TAR.LZMA-Format zur Verfügung.)
FreeBASIC unterstützt seit dieser Version offiziell auch die Betriebssysteme FreeBSD, OpenBSD und NetBSD, darüber hinaus wurde die Kompatibilität zu Linux x64 verbessert. Eine der wesentlichen Neuerungen ist der C-Emitter, der das Portieren von FreeBASIC auf neue Plattformen erleichtern und die optimierte Compilierung eigener Programme ermöglichen soll. Der C-Emitter ist offiziell allerdings noch instabil und der dazu nötige Compiler gcc ist im Paket standardmäßig nicht enthalten.
Im Folgenden einige der Neuerungen im Überblick (siehe auch Changelog):
- C-Emitter
- Optimierung der Gleitkommazahl-Behandlung
- Support für drei neue Plattformen (FreeBSD, OpenBSD und NetBSD)
- Verbesserung der Kompatibilität zu QB (DRAW)
- Arrays, die ihre Größe bei der Initialisierung selbst erkennen und festlegen
- BYREF nun auch mit zstring ptr und wstring ptr möglich
- Multimonitor-Unterstützung für GDI- und OpenGL-Grafikfunktionalität
Da es sich um ein eigenständiges Release handelt, wird empfohlen, eine noch installierte, alte Version zunächst zu deinstallieren oder dies vom Setup-Assistenten erledigen zu lassen.
Bitte beachten Sie, dass es sich bei diesem Download um den bloßen Compiler handelt. Eine Entwicklungsumgebung ist nicht enthalten, sondern muss noch separat installiert werden, falls noch keine vorhanden ist. Weitere Informationen...